Highlights
Are people in Lenoir older or younger than people in Henrietta?
- The Median Age in Lenoir is 0.5 years older than in Henrietta.

Are housing costs cheaper in Lenoir or Henrietta?
- Lenoir housing costs are 33.4% more expensive than Henrietta hous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Lenoir or Henrietta?
- The average commute for residents of Lenoir is 3.1 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Henrietta.

Things to do in Lenoir?
Lenoir, North Carolina is located in Caldwell County providing its citizens great recreational activities such as Lenoir Golf Course plus stores like Valmead Shopping Center and dining spots near DaVinci's Italian Restaurant.
